"My Octopus and a Teacher" is the eighteenth episode of broadcast season 33 of The Simpsons and the seven hundred twenty-fourth episode overall. It originally aired on April 24, 2022. The episode was written by Carolyn Omine and directed by Rob Oliver. It guest stars Kerry Washington as Rayshelle Peyton.

After Bart finds out that his new teacher, Rayshelle Peyton, is the same woman who saved him from drowning, he struggles to handle his feelings toward her. Meanwhile, Lisa befriends an octopus, about whom she makes a documentary...
